Maria Montessori was a scientist. She was a physician, educator, feminist, barrier-breaker, and innovator who utilized scientific observation and experience working with young children to design learning materials and a classroom environment which foster a child’s natural desire to learn. Dr. Montessori opened her first school in 1907, and today there are close to 4,000 certified Montessori schools in the United States and about 7,000 worldwide. Even though the field of modern neuroscience and brain research did not exist during Dr. Montessori's time, her theories and methodologies have withstood the test of time, and today neuroscience and brain research fully support the Montessori methodology. Greensboro Montessori Schools visit with Dr. Steven Hughes brought together the worlds of Montessori schooling, brain development, and research. Dr. Hughes is a board-certified pediatric neuropsychologist and past president of The American Academy of Pediatric Neuropsychology. His research interests are on what promotes the growth of executive functions, social-emotional skills, and moral reasoning.
